Pre Learner Course

  • If you currently have no motorcycle licence, the Pre Learner course is the first step you need to take.
  • The Pre Learner course is a compulsory 2 day course run over approximately 6-7 hours each day to get your motorcycle learners licence in Queensland.
  • To be eligible for this course you are required to have held your car licence for at least 1 year.
  • You must be able to ride a push bike as a minimum before starting this course.  It is also helpful that you understand how to change gears.

What to expect:

  • The Pre Learner course was designed to prepare learner riders by enabling them to gain basic riding knowledge and motorcycle handling skills in a safe environment before riding on-road.
  • During the course we will explain, demonstrate and then practice with lots of feedback a number of training competencies, including: the basics of operating a motorcycle, the importance of looking ahead, roadcraft tactics, riding curves & slow riding, steering & braking, judgement & giving way, riding strategies and finish with a simulated road ride. We also cover the importance of protective gear and creating safe riding practices.
  • Students must complete day 1 prior to day 2. Please note that you have 30 days to complete both days once you have started the Pre Learner course.

Once you complete the course:

  • Once you have competently completed both days of the Pre Learner course, you will be eligible to apply for your Motorcycle Learners Licence by completing the Motorcycle Knowledge.
  • If you want to test your General knowledge go online and do a Practice Road Rule Test.
  • Customers can sit the test online (Motorcycle Knowledge Test) or, in person at the Department of Transport.
  • Riders are required to hold a Motorcycle Learners Permit for a minimum of 3 months before being eligible to upgrade to a Restricted Motorcycle Licence (RE).
  • When your 3 months are completed we will contact you, letting you know you are know eligible to Upgrade to RE when you are ready.

RE Course

  • If you currently have your motorcycle learners licence (RE-L) and are wanting to upgrade to your restricted licence (RE) then you will need to complete this course.
  • This course is approximately an 8 hour day and will allow you to ride any bike that is a LAMS Approved Bike.
  • To be eligible for this course you are required to have held your motorbike learners licence for 90 days and have completed your Hazard Perception Test.
  • You will be expected to be able to do tight U-turns, Figure 8 exercise, Firm Braking, Hill starts, Highway speeds, Interact with Traffic, Roundabouts and turning across traffic, etc.  Mark recommends that you have done at least 1000-2000 klms on your bike before coming to do the course especially if you are new to riding.  If in doubt, give us a call and we offer Refresher/Practice lessons.

What to expect:

  • The Restricted licence course is a competency based training and assessment program designed to help learner riders further develop their riding knowledge and motorcycle handling skills.
  • The course is a mix between training area and on-road activities.
  • You will receive feedback from our friendly and professional instructor,  continuing to correct and develop your riding technique during the course.

Training Area Exercises

  • Figure 8’s – turn at a low speed with control  – 5m circles, 2m apart, 2m lanes
  • Slow Ride – control the bike at a slow walking pace.
  • Slalom – weave around obstacles.
  • Controlled stop/ Emergency stop – bring the bike to a smooth stop whilst downshifting.
  • Simulated Road Ride.

Road Ride

  • You will complete a 2 hour road ride where the aim is to develop your riding skills and ensure you have the skills and knowledge to respond to potential hazards.

Please note that you have 30 days to complete your Q Ride assessment once you start it.

Once you complete the course:

  • Once you have completed the course and are deemed competent, your competency declaration will be processed online and you will be able to apply for your Restricted (RE) licence online or, you can apply in person at the Department of Transport.
  • You are required to hold the Restricted licence for a minimum of 2 years before you are eligible to ride and upgrade to your Unrestricted (R) bike licence.  Once your 2 years is completed, your RE-O automatically becomes a R-L allowing you to ride a R bike as a learner.  You must be accompanied and display a L plate.  You can buy, including finance and insure, a R bike so you can get some practice before doing the licence.

R Course

  • If you currently have your restricted motorbike licence (RE) and are wanting to upgrade to your open motorbike licence (R), this course is for you.
  • To be eligible for this course you are required to have held your Restricted (RE) licence for 2 years.
  • This course is approximately 3.5 hours and is suitable for riders who have significant riding experience and can confidently ride a bike.  If you are not sure if you are ready for this course, give Mark a call and he can organize a time for a lesson for some training.
  • Once your 2 years is completed, your RE-O automatically becomes a R-L allowing you to ride a R bike as a learner.  You must be accompanied and display a L plate.  You can buy, including finance and insure, a R bike so you can get some practice before doing the licence.

What to expect:

  • The Unrestricted licence course is a competency based training and assessment course designed to reinforce and further develop your riding knowledge, cognitive skills and risk management strategies.  You will complete a simulated road ride where you will need to demonstrate a range of skills and good riding behaviours.

Training Area Exercises

  • Tight Manoeuvre – turn at a low speed with control.
  • Hazard Avoidance – avoid an obstacle in a corner.
  • Controlled Stop – stopping to a point.

Road Ride

  • You will complete a 2 hour road ride where you show that you are competent managing routine and more complex riding situations on a more powerful motorcycle. This is to reinforce appropriate riding attitudes and to minimise harm due to inappropriate riding skills and behaviours or poor risk management.

Once you complete the course:

  • Once you have completed the course and are deemed competent your competency declaration will be processed online and you will be able to apply for your Unrestricted (R) licence online or, you can apply in person at the Department of Transport.
